Constructed with meticulous engineering, these vessels offer resistance to elements like saltwater corrosion, intense ultraviolet radiation, and extreme temperature fluctuations.
The user experience with an FRP boat is remarkable due to its reduced maintenance requirements. Unlike wooden vessels that demand regular upkeep to prevent rot or metal boats that require anti-rust treatment, FRP boats are virtually impervious to such deterioration. This quality translates into a more affordable and less time-consuming upkeep regimen, ensuring that boat owners can spend more time enjoying the water and less on repairs.

From an expertise viewpoint, professionals in the marine construction industry laud FRP for its versatility. Crafting boats from fiberglass reinforced plastic involves sophisticated techniques that have been honed over decades. The process starts with forming a mold that defines the boat's shape, followed by laying multiple layers of fiberglass fabric and saturating them with resin. This method allows for the creation of seamless, aerodynamically efficient vessels without the joint vulnerabilities found in metal constructions.
